Vaccination

COVID-19 Vaccine Training: General Overview of Immunization Best Practices for Healthcare Providers

Learn about COVID-19 Emergency Use Authorization and safety as well as vaccine storage, handling, administration, and reporting. Free CE.

Self-paced online course: COVID-19 Vaccine Training


Pfizer-BioNTech (COMIRNATY) COVID-19 Vaccine: What Healthcare Professionals Need to Know

Learn about the COVID-19 vaccine manufactured by Pfizer Pharmaceuticals, based on the recommendations of the Advisory Committee on Immunization Practices and guidance from the manufacturer. Free CE.

Self-paced online course: Pfizer-BioNTech (COMIRNATY) COVID-19 Vaccine


Moderna COVID-19 Vaccine: What Healthcare Professionals Need to Know

Learn about the COVID-19 vaccine manufactured by Moderna, Inc., based on the recommendations of the Advisory Committee on Immunization Practices and guidance from the manufacturer. Free CE.

Self-paced online course: Moderna COVID-19 Vaccine


Janssen COVID-19 Vaccine (Johnson & Johnson): What Healthcare Professionals Need to Know

Learn about the COVID-19 vaccine manufactured by Johnson & Johnson, based on the recommendations of the Advisory Committee on Immunization Practices and guidance from the manufacturer. Free CE.

Self-paced online course: Janssen COVID-19 Vaccine

COVID-19 Vaccine Webinar Series

Learn about COVID-19 vaccination topics. Webinars cover how to become a vaccination provider, host a vaccination clinic, and administer more than one vaccine on the same day. Other topics include vaccine safety, vaccine storage and transport, and best practices to prevent vaccine administration errors. Free CE.

Webinars: COVID-19 Vaccine Webinar Series
